Anthony C. Mottola, "A.C." to his friends, is discovered murdered in the rubble of his burned-out music store. Rooke Limestone County Sheriff Deputy Hal Blaine is assigned to the case. He is aided in the search for answers by the county's medical examiner, Judee Sill.
